Poor claims experience no feedback on claim almost 3 weeks
My geyser burst in my garage, i discovered this on the 21 September around 06:45,i contacted the emergency assistance number and plumber was only sent through at about 11:00,i was then told after the inspection the geyser needs to be replaced and i must pay about R5000 first then it will be repaced, i did an eft immediately, the new geyser was fitted against my cupboard door so i cant even open the cupboard door, photos were alao taken of the resultant damages. An assessor from digi call then visited my premises on the 23 September 2021 and he again took photos. On the 4 October 2021 a contractor from Kzn kitchen came yet again to take measurements and photos. I called kzn kitchens on the 5 October 2021 and they confirmed that they have submitred their quote and they are awaiting feedback from the insurance company regarding an electrician who is going to remove and then put back the inverter system that is in the cupboard that needs to be replaced. To date i have not gotten any feedback from absa. This claim is now going on 3 weeks for such a small claim. Claim number is *** as per Digicall. I called Digicall as well on the 05/10/2021 and they say i must call ABSA for feedback.
